Minimum Qualifications Budget Fellow must possess a minimum of a Bachelor’s degree. Starting salaries depend upon level of education and type of work experience, and annual salary increases are dependent on satisfactory performance:

• Budget Fellow I: $43,814- A Bachelor’s degree. Advances to Budget Fellow II after one (1) year of satisfactory service.

• Budget Fellow II: $47,977– A Master’s degree in public administration, economics, business administration, public policy, public affairs or a closely related administrative or managerial field; or, a Bachelor’s degree and two (2) years of professional work experience including one (1) year in public administration. Advances to Budget Fellow III after one year of satisfactory service.

• Budget Fellow III: $51,905– A Master’s degree as specified for Budget Fellow II and one (1) year of professional budgeting experience within a governmental jurisdiction; or, a Master’s degree in any field and two (2) years of professional work experience including one (1) year in public administration; or, a Bachelor’s degree and four (4) years of professional work experience including one (1) year of public administration. Eligible for annual salary increases based on performance.

Applicants must have demonstrated strong quantitative, analytical, writing, research and interpersonal skills; perform well independently and as part of a team; communicate clearly and concisely; and have significant experience in Microsoft Excel and Word.

Duties Description This position will serve as the lead examiner for the Office of Mental Health (OMH) State Operation and Capital budgets within the Mental Hygiene Labor Relations Unit and will be responsible for the development, negotiation, and execution of the $1.9 billion State Operations and $300 million Capital program budgets for OMH.

OMH is responsible for coordinating services for more than 700,000 New Yorkers with mental illness through its operation of State psychiatric centers and its regulation and oversight of more than 4,500 community-based and outpatient programs operated by not-for-profit providers and local governments throughout the State. These services are funded through a combination of Federal, State, and local resources. In addition to the budgeting and monitoring of annual operating and capital spending, the successful candidate will also be involved in several key initiatives, including:

• Ensuring appropriate community-based programs and funding are available to individuals transitioning from psychiatric centers to more integrated community-based support systems;
• Managing a State workforce of over 14,000 employees and a State-operated census of close to 4,000 individuals; and
• Conducting analysis and collaborating with other units/agencies in order to implement best practices to reduce overtime, administrative leave, and worker's compensation usage at OMH.
